Encounter: Journal for Pentecostal Ministry
The Assemblies of God Theological
Seminary is proud
to introduce Encounter: Journal for Pentecostal
Ministry, a scholarly publication
intended
to serve the Church of Jesus Christ by bringing transforming
theological and professional insight to bear on the practice
of ministry in the Pentecostal tradition.
